Output 93ffc123a275f87b0000af4caaa4f4f2f39e6ecfafe53024173ad4e5d78b6bc6:26

value
41000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aabef1d20b36c0fe2c9b0fdbe7ed14375c8ad9eb OP_EQUALVERIFY OP_CHECKSIG
address
LanmstUhpUyec7BuWRybD8HdzLCiUEbhZy
transaction
93ffc123a275f87b0000af4caaa4f4f2f39e6ecfafe53024173ad4e5d78b6bc6
spent
true